Kids Academy asserts that mastering place value is essential for developing math capabilities, like addition and subtraction. Using base ten blocks to regroup numbers aids kids in becoming numerate, plus it prepares them for further math operations. We have an illustrative worksheet that plus provides the cubes needed to understand the process of trading ones for tens.

Basic addition skills and place value understanding are foundational elements for children aged 7-8 and are crucial for several reasons.

Firstly, addition skills are fundamental to more advanced math concepts. Children who master basic addition will find it easier to grasp subsequent topics like subtraction, multiplication, and division. Early competence builds confidence and a positive attitude towards math, which is essential for continued success in this subject.

Secondly, a solid understanding of place value underscores many aspects of mathematics. Place value helps children comprehend the position of each digit in a number and its corresponding value. This knowledge is vital not just for addition but also for understanding larger numbers and performing more complex operations such as carrying over and borrowing in arithmetic operations.

Furthermore, these skills are integral to real-life scenarios, helping children in tasks such as handling money, measuring ingredients for recipes, and telling time. They are practical skills that make day-to-day tasks manageable and comprehensible.

Finally, fostering strong basic math skills and understanding of place values enhances cognitive development. Engaging in these activities strengthens problem-solving abilities, logical thinking, and attention to detail, which are valuable skills across all areas of learning and in everyday life. Thus, ensuring children have a robust foundation in these areas is indispensable for their educational journey and beyond.
